How to Inspire Your Next Project with Dashboard Design Examples
Briefly

The article emphasizes the importance of well-designed dashboards in making sense of vast data. It categorizes dashboards into four types: operational, analytical, strategic, and informational, each serving distinct purposes. Best practices for designing effective dashboards include understanding the audience, balancing aesthetics with functionality, ensuring responsiveness, avoiding clutter, and leveraging integration features. The piece also highlights ClickUp Dashboards as a tool for visualizing productivity and workflows, stressing that effective design prioritizes meaningful insights to empower users in decision-making.
